Introduction

Islamic memorial gifts serve as a meaningful way to honor and remember loved ones who have passed away. These gifts can provide comfort to grieving families and friends, offering them a tangible connection to their cherished memories. Common Islamic memorial gifts include items such as prayer mats, Quran stands, and engraved plaques featuring verses from the Quran or heartfelt messages. These gifts not only express condolences but also serve as a reminder of the loved one’s faith and the impact they had on those around them.

When selecting an Islamic memorial gift, consider the following:
  • Personalization: Customized gifts, such as engraved items, can add a special touch.
  • Religious Significance: Gifts that reflect Islamic teachings or values can resonate deeply.
  • Quality: Choose items that are made from durable materials, ensuring they will last as a lasting tribute.
Many families appreciate gifts that can be used in daily prayers or remembrance, such as beautifully crafted prayer beads or Islamic art pieces that can be displayed in the home. These gifts are often seen as a way to keep the memory of the deceased alive, fostering a sense of peace and connection. Remember, the thoughtfulness behind the gift is what truly matters, and choosing something that reflects the recipient’s beliefs can provide comfort during a difficult time.
